JOB DESCRIPTION:
The Customs Compliance Specialist will assume responsibility for the organization and continuous improvement of Krones, Inc. import/export trade compliance strategy, programs, and related projects to ensure compliance with the import/export controls, laws, and regulations in all countries where Krones does business.

  • Develop and drive import/export control compliance.
  • Handle import/export procedures to ensure compliance with U.S. Customs regulations including HTS, denied party screening, ECCN coding, NAFTA, valuation, country of origin, licensing, SAP data base, commercial invoices, recordkeeping, and special trade programs.
  • Maintain and update Krones Customs Compliance Export Policy and Procedure Manual.
  • Facilitate with Engineering and Supply Chain in their responsibility to provide technical expertise regarding parts and component classifications. Determine technology controls and licensing.
  • Create and conduct employee training programs, including daily reference material.
  • Interact substantially with Krones Group, parent, and subsidiary companies to determine import/export requirements and partnering to develop ongoing compliant business/sales/operational strategies worldwide.
  • Communications, forms, documentation, and interaction with US Customs, government agencies, brokers and/or freight forwarders.
  • Create and provide reports as required for daily job functions or as upper management requires.
  • Regularly moderate resources and stay abreast of ongoing changes and updates to US Government regulation, as they apply to Krones exports.
  • Perform any other duties as assigned.


QUALIFICATIONS:

 

Education: High school education or equivalent required.

Experience and/or Training: Minimum 3-5 years of experience including policy, procedure, work instructions, HTS, COO, NAFTA, denied party screening, ECCN, and licensing. Experience directing policy compliance, tracking regulatory changes, as well as training and effectively communicating across all levels of the organization, including senior executives and functional groups.
